Write an equation of the line that passes through the point P(0,0) and is perpendicular to the line y=-5x+3

Answers

Answer:

[tex]y=\frac{1}{5}x[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

We want to write an equation of a line that passes through the point P(0, 0) and is perpendicular to the line y=-5x+3.

First, let's figure out the slope of our new line. Remember that slopes of perpendicular lines are negative reciprocals of each other.

So, to find our new slope, we need to flip our old slope and multiply by -1. So, our new slope is:

[tex]-5[/tex]

Flip:

[tex]-\frac{1}{5}[/tex]

Multiply by a negative:

[tex]=\frac{1}{5}[/tex]

So, the slope of our new line is 1/5.

To find our equation, we can use the slope-intercept form:

[tex]y=mx+b[/tex]

Where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ept.

As previously determined, our slope is 1/5.

Note that (0, 0) is our y-intercept (and also our x-intercept). So, substitute 0 for b. Therefore, our new equation is:

[tex]y=\frac{1}{5}x+0[/tex]

Simplify:

[tex]y=\frac{1}{5}x[/tex]

And we're done!

I don’t understand this someone pls help me! (Question 10)

Answers

Answer:

  a. f(n) = n(n+1)/2

  b. 351

  c. 19

  d. no; n would not be an integer for f(n) = 17.

Step-by-step explanation:

a. The terms are 1, 3, 6, 10, ...

Each term has the term number added to the previous term. That is, first differences are 3-1 = 2, 6-3 = 3, 10-6 = 4. These differences have a constant difference of 1.

When the 2nd differences are constant, a 2nd degree polynomial can describe the sequence. It is a little bit of trouble to find that polynomial.

For the polynomial ...

  [tex]f(n)=an^2+bn+c[/tex]

We can substitute values for n and f(n) to get 3 equations in 3 unknowns:

  [tex]1=a\cdot1^2+b\cdot1+c\\\\3=a\cdot2^2+b\cdot2+c\\\\6=a\cdot3^2+b\cdot3+c[/tex]

Solving these equations by your favorite method gives ...

  (a, b, c) = (1/2, 1/2, 0)

That is, the function representing the relationship is ...

  f(n) = n(n+1)/2 . . . . the function describing the relationship

__

b. f(26) = 26(27) = 13(27) = 351 . . . . the number of squares in term 26

__

c. The number of the term having 190 squares can be found by solving ...

  n(n +1)/2 = 190

  n(n +1) = 380 = 19(20)

The 19th term will have 190 squares.

__

d. Terms 5 and 6 are 15 and 21.

17 is not the value of one of the terms in this sequence.
